    Abstract Shared parking is recognized as a promising solution to tackle the parking space shortage problem in population-dense cities. However, peer-to-peer shared parking by individuals is not easy to implement in such cities, because it requires the consent of the majority of residents and the facilitation of the property management agency. In this paper we propose a new model for shared parking driven by morning commute. We consider the agencies of residential parking lots as the players to make collective decisions on behalf of the property owners, and study the market design problem for this new shared parking model. Specifically, we investigate how to assign to each agency a quota of parking spaces from every other agency that its commuters can book in advance through an e-platform and how to specify transfer prices for exchanges, with the objective to maximize agencies’ welfare. Our problem is a new discrete many-to-many exchange economy with multi-unit valuation. We design a stable exchange scheme based on the trading network theory, and show that this new scheme is efficient and in the core. In the real environment with random cancelations over time, we further develop a rolling-horizon rebalance procedure that minimizes the welfare loss. Computational experiments using real-world data demonstrate that our stable exchange scheme substantially outperforms the commonly adopted solutions based on the first-come-first-serve protocol and also reveal a variety of interesting insights for practice.
